James Watson, who helped discover DNA’s double-helix structure, has died at the age of 97.
Watson died in hospice care following a brief illness, his son said on Friday, Nov. 7, according to the Associated Press .
The American scientist's death occurred earlier this week on Long Island, according to The New York Times . Cold Spring Harbor Laboratory, where Watson previously worked, confirmed Watson’s death in an article on Friday.
